在《魔兽世界》中提升中文文本的复制效率,需要综合运用插件优化、宏命令编写、界面设置调整及第三方工具辅助等多种手段。以下从五个核心维度展开详细分析:
聊天复制插件(如要求提到的工具)是提升效率的核心方案。这类插件通过界面按钮或快捷键实现聊天框文本的快速选中与复制,避免了传统手动拖拽的繁琐操作。安装插件后,玩家仅需在聊天框点击目标消息,即可通过预设按钮将整段文字(包括时间戳、发送者信息)自动复制到剪贴板,效率提升幅度可达300%-500%。
进阶应用:部分插件支持过滤规则设置,例如仅复制包含特定关键词(如“金团分配”“任务坐标”)的聊天内容,减少无效信息的干扰。
通过编写自定义宏(参考要求的宏框架),可将复杂操作简化为单键触发。以下宏可实现选中当前聊天框最新消息并复制:
lua
/run ChatFrame1:SetScript("OnMouseUp", function ChatFrame1:CopyToClipboard end)
将此宏绑定至快捷键后,玩家按一次键即可完成复制。更复杂的宏可结合条件判断(如仅复制来自队伍或公会的消息),但需注意暴雪对宏功能的限制,避免触发违规检测。
1.字体与缩放设置:增大聊天框字体(通过/console chatFontSize 14
命令)并调整界面缩放比例(/console uiscale 0.8
),使文本更易选中。
2.分栏管理:将不同频道(如队伍、交易、系统提示)分配至独立聊天框,减少信息混杂。通过插件(如Prat 3.0)可自定义分栏规则,精准定位目标内容。
对于需要批量复制文本的玩家(如金团记录员),可借助Aster多用户系统(要求)实现多账号并行操作。该工具将单台电脑虚拟为多立设备,每个窗口可独立运行游戏客户端。配合同步宏设置,可实现跨窗口的文本同步复制,但需注意:
1.NGA论坛资源(要求):艾泽拉斯国家地理(NGA)提供大量玩家自研插件及宏库,快速拍卖行信息复制工具”可一键生成物品价格报告。
2.Lua脚本优化(参考要求):对于自行开发插件的用户,需注意避免频繁创建临时表(如重用aux
表结构),并通过collectgarbage("incremental")
调整垃圾回收策略,减少卡顿。
| 操作场景 | 传统耗时(秒) | 优化方案耗时(秒) | 效率提升倍数 |
||-|--|--|
| 复制单条聊天消息 | 3-5(拖拽选择)| 0.5-1(插件按钮) | 3-10倍 |
| 批量导出交易记录 | 120+(手动整理)| 20(宏+分栏过滤) | 6倍 |
| 多角色信息同步 | 无法实现 | 10(Aster多开) | N/A |
通过上述方案组合,玩家可显著降低文本处理的时间成本,将更多精力投入核心玩法。建议优先尝试插件与宏方案,再根据需求逐步扩展高阶工具。